EeroQ Advances Electron on Helium Qubit Technology for Quantum Computing

Summary

EeroQ is advancing its Electron on Helium (eHe) qubit technology, a unique quantum computing modality that uses electrons bound to the surface of superfluid helium as qubits. While less mature than other quantum computing approaches, this method offers potential advantages including long coherence times, small qubit size, fast gates, and CMOS compatibility.
